The Power Outage Conundrum: When the Lights Go Out in Vail Valley

In the picturesque Vail Valley, a region renowned for its stunning landscapes and vibrant communities, a power outage has plunged tens of thousands of residents into darkness. This situation, affecting a staggering 27,000 customers, is more than just an inconvenience; it's a stark reminder of our dependence on energy and the challenges that arise when the grid falters.

The Outage Unveiled

The energy provider, Holy Cross, has been swift to acknowledge the issue, partnering with Xcel Energy to tackle the problem. However, the lack of an estimated restoration time is a cause for concern. Residents are left in limbo, wondering when their daily routines can resume. What makes this particularly intriguing is the scale of the outage, spanning across Vail, Avon, Eagle, and Gypsum. It's a testament to the interconnectedness of our modern infrastructure.

Communication Challenges

One aspect that deserves scrutiny is the communication strategy. The 5:37 p.m. update from Holy Cross reveals a hiccup in their system, with incorrect notifications sent to customers. This minor detail is a significant insight into the challenges of crisis communication. In my experience, managing public expectations during such events is a delicate balance. While transparency is essential, providing inaccurate information can erode trust. This incident underscores the importance of precise and timely updates, a lesson for all utility providers.
